Will Cher Return?
A major highlight of the second film was the surprise appearance of music icon Cher as Ruby Sheridan, Donna's mother and Sophie's grandmother. Her rendition of ABBA's "Fernando" was a showstopper. While her involvement in a third film has not been confirmed, the creative team would undoubtedly want the legendary singer to reprise her role, continuing the family's dramatic legacy.

Broadway's Return in 2025
The musical is also making a triumphant return to its original Broadway home, the Winter Garden Theatre, with performances resuming in August 2025. The Broadway cast features Christine Sherrill as Donna, Amy Weaver as Sophie, and a new ensemble ready to bring the Greek island fantasy to New York City.
